Tiger Woods Pictured Publicly Following DUI Arrest

Golf icon Tiger Woods was recently photographed publicly for the first time following his arrest on suspicion of driving under the influence (DUI) in Jupiter, Florida. The images, which quickly circulated, showed the celebrated athlete in a white t-shirt and a baseball cap, entering a dark SUV. This public appearance occurred shortly after his release from jail, stemming from an incident on Monday, May 29, 2017.

The arrest unfolded when law enforcement officers found Woods asleep at the wheel of his Mercedes-Benz, with the engine running, near his home in Jupiter. Despite the circumstances, Woods subsequently issued a statement attributing the incident not to alcohol consumption, but rather to an unexpected adverse reaction to prescribed medications. He explicitly stated that he had passed two breathalyzer tests, registering 0.00 for alcohol, reinforcing his claim that alcohol was not a factor in the event.

Details of the Arrest and Tiger Woods’ Statement

The specifics of the arrest indicate that officers approached Woods’ vehicle at approximately 3 a.m. on Memorial Day. Reports confirm that the vehicle was stationary, partially blocking a bike lane on the side of the road. While initial concerns revolved around potential alcohol impairment, Woods’ subsequent breathalyzer results contradicted this, showing no presence of alcohol. In his official statement released shortly after his release from custody, Tiger Woods clarified the situation. He expressed full cooperation with law enforcement and took responsibility for the incident, but emphasized that the unexpected reaction to his prescribed medications, rather than alcohol, led to his impaired state. He also apologized to his family, friends, and fans for the incident.

The medications in question were reportedly for pain management following his recent fourth back surgery in April, as well as sleep medication. Woods had been recovering from a fusion surgery, which doctors hoped would alleviate persistent back pain that had significantly impacted his golf career for several years. The statement from Tiger Woods underscored the challenges he faced during his recovery period, highlighting the complexities of managing post-operative pain and sleep issues. His candor in addressing the situation, while acknowledging the seriousness of the DUI charge, aimed to provide clarity amidst swirling speculation.

The Path Forward for Tiger Woods

Looking ahead, Tiger Woods faces a legal process. His arraignment date was set for July 5 in Palm Beach County court. In Florida, DUI charges can carry significant penalties, including fines, license suspension, and mandatory substance abuse courses, even for a first-time offense. The specifics of Woods’ case, particularly the role of prescription medication and his clean breathalyzer results, will likely be central to the legal proceedings. The incident adds another layer to what has already been a challenging period for the golf legend, marked by recurring injuries and efforts to return to professional play.
